Which kind of material would be prone to liquefaction during an earthquake?

a. water-saturated sand
b. dry compacted clay
c. sedimentary rock with horizontal layering
d. volcanic rock that is very porous?

the kind of material would be prone to liquefaction during an earthquake was A. Water-saturated sand
